From owner-freebsd-questions@FreeBSD.ORG Sat Apr 2 08:22:48 2011 Return-Path: Delivered-To: questions@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 772B4106566B for ; Sat, 2 Apr 2011 08:22:48 +0000 (UTC) (envelope-from david.marec@davenulle.org) Received: from smtp.lamaiziere.net (net.lamaiziere.net [91.121.44.19]) by mx1.freebsd.org (Postfix) with ESMTP id 464998FC18 for ; Sat, 2 Apr 2011 08:22:48 +0000 (UTC) Received: from www.lamaiziere.net (unknown [192.168.1.1]) by smtp.lamaiziere.net (Postfix) with ESMTP id 9161363307B for ; Sat, 2 Apr 2011 10:04:08 +0200 (CEST) Received: from 93.28.96.112 (SquirrelMail authenticated user david.nul) by lamaiziere.net with HTTP; Sat, 2 Apr 2011 10:04:08 +0200 (CEST) Message-ID: <2a45fcd55d08a7465370ad0acf8e724c.squirrel@lamaiziere.net> Date: Sat, 2 Apr 2011 10:04:08 +0200 (CEST) From: "David Marec" To: questions@freebsd.org User-Agent: SquirrelMail/1.4.17 MIME-Version: 1.0 Content-Type: text/plain;charset=iso-8859-15 Content-Transfer-Encoding: 8bit X-Priority: 3 (Normal) Importance: Normal Cc: Subject: About using setenv within Login.conf, then interpolate X-BeenThere: freebsd-questions@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list Reply-To: david.marec@davenulle.org List-Id: User questions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sat, 02 Apr 2011 08:22:48 -0000 Hi, I am using the following /etc/login.conf cap-file, that defines the "french class" as an interpolate from "default": <--- ---> default:\ :passwd_format=md5:\ :copyright=/etc/COPYRIGHT:\ :welcome=/etc/motd:\ :setenv=MAIL=/var/mail/$\ ,BLOCKSIZE=K\ ,FTP_PASSIVE_MODE=YES\ [...etc.] french|Utilisateurs francophones:\ :charset=ISO-8859-15:\ :setenv=LC_COLLATE=fr_FR.ISO8859-15\ ,LC_CTYPE=fr_FR.ISO8859-15\ ,LC_MESSAGES=fr_FR.ISO8859-15\ ,LC_MONETARY=fr_FR.ISO8859-15\ ,LC_NUMERIC=fr_FR.ISO8859-15\ ,LC_TIME=fr_FR.ISO8859-15\ ,LC_ALL=fr_FR.ISO8859-15:\ :lang=fr_FR.ISO8859-15:\ :tc=default: <--- ---> But, the "setenv" tags that are defined for "default" are not set for french user: david:~>pw showuser $user david:*:1001:0:french:0:0:David Marec:/home/david:/bin/tcsh david:~>setenv | egrep -i \(mail\|ftp\) david:~>su -l Password: root:~#pw showuser $user root:*:0:0::0:0:Charlie &:/root:/bin/csh root:~#setenv | egrep -i \(mail\|ftp\) FTP_PASSIVE_MODE=YES MAIL=/var/mail/root What that i missed ? -- Cordialement, -- David Marec: http://user.lamaiziere.net/david/Site/ http://www.freebsd.org/fr/ http://www.diablotins.org/